Zero-Emission Vehicle (ZEV)

Zero-emission vehicles (ZEVs) are vehicles that produce no tailpipe exhaust emissions of any criteria pollutants or their precursors, nor any greenhouse gasses when in operation. This category primarily includes vehicles powered entirely by batteries or fuel cells, as well as plug-in hybrid vehicles that can operate on both gasoline and electricity. Often referred to as all-electric vehicles, ZEVs are integral to efforts in reducing environmental impact and promoting sustainable transportation.

The advancement of ZEV technology not only helps in cutting down on urban air pollution but also plays a crucial role in combating climate change by minimizing the release of carbon emissions. These vehicles are increasingly becoming a viable option for consumers and fleets alike, driven by technological improvements, supportive policies, and growing environmental awareness among the public.
